Transverse elastic waves behave differently in nonlinear isotropic and anisotropic media. Quadratically nonlinear coupling in the evolution equations for wave amplitudes is not possible in isotropic solids, but such a coupling may occur for certain directions in anisotropic materials. We identify the expression responsible for the coupling and we derive coupled canonical evolution equations for transverse wave amplitudes in the case of two-fold and three-fold symmetry acoustic axes. We illustrate our considerations by examples for a cubic crystal.
